Primary Care Services
Routine Check-ups and Physicals
Amarillo family physicians provide routine check-ups and physicals for patients of all ages. These appointments are essential for monitoring your overall health, detecting potential health issues early on, and administering necessary vaccinations.
Acute Care
When you or your family members experience sudden illness or injury, Amarillo family physicians offer prompt and effective acute care. They can diagnose and treat common health concerns, such as coughs, colds, flu, minor cuts, and sprains.
Chronic Disease Management
If you or a loved one has a chronic health condition, such as diabetes, high blood pressure, or asthma, Amarillo family physicians provide comprehensive disease management plans. They work closely with you to develop tailored treatment regimens, monitor your progress, and make necessary adjustments.

Choosing the Right Doctor
Finding the right Amarillo family physician for you and your family requires some research. Here are a few tips:
- Ask for recommendations from friends, family, or your insurance provider.
- Check online reviews and testimonials.
- Consider the doctor’s experience, certifications, and areas of expertise.
- Schedule a consultation to meet the doctor and get a feel for their communication style and bedside manner.
